Pruning arborvitae can address several common problems that affect these evergreen trees. Overgrown or densely packed foliage can hinder proper air circulation, increasing the risk of fungal infections or pest infestations. Additionally, damaged or diseased branches can compromise the overall health of the tree if not removed promptly. Regular pruning can also prevent the trees from becoming too tall or wide for the property, reducing safety hazards and making maintenance easier. By maintaining the proper shape and size, pruning services contribute to the long-term health and vitality of arborvitae trees.

Per-Tree Cost - Arborvitae pruning services typically range from $75 to $200 per tree, depending on size and complexity. Smaller trees may cost less, while larger, mature trees can be on the higher end of the spectrum.
Hourly Rates - Some service providers charge between $50 and $100 per hour for arborvitae pruning. The total cost depends on the number of trees and the time required to complete the work.
Bulk Service Pricing - For multiple trees, contractors may offer package deals averaging $300 to $800 for pruning several arborvitae. Costs vary based on tree size and the extent of trimming needed.
Service Area Variations - Costs can fluctuate based on location, with prices in Mead, WA, typically aligning with regional rates.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ific property con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should arborvitae be pruned? The frequency of pruning depends on the desired shape and health of the shrub, but typically, arborvitae benefit from annual or biannual pruning to maintain their appearance and vitality.
What is the best time of year to prune arborvitae? The ideal time to prune arborvitae is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ins, though light trimming can be done in summer if needed.
Can arborvitae be over-pruned? Yes, over-pruning can harm the plant’s health and appearance; professional pruning services can help ensure proper techniques are used to avoid this.
What tools are used for arborvitae pruning? Common tools include pruning shears, hedge trimmers, and loppers, depending on the size and density of the branches.
